瀏覽代碼

fix build error

Ilya Georgievsky 10 年之前
父節點
當前提交
e362cde998
共有 1 個文件被更改,包括 4 次插入1 次删除
  1. 4 1
      celery/result.py

+ 4 - 1
celery/result.py

@@ -580,7 +580,7 @@ class ResultSet(ResultBase):
             interval=interval, callback=callback, no_ack=no_ack, on_message=on_message)
 
     def join(self, timeout=None, propagate=True, interval=0.5,
-             callback=None, no_ack=True):
+             callback=None, no_ack=True, on_message=None):
         """Gathers the results of all tasks as a list in order.
 
         .. note::
@@ -632,6 +632,9 @@ class ResultSet(ResultBase):
         time_start = monotonic()
         remaining = None
 
+        if on_message is not None:
+            raise Exception('Your backend not suppored on_message callback')
+
         results = []
         for result in self.results:
             remaining = None